At 10.45 yesterday the four America’s
Cup teams competing in the Jeep Challenge 2006 set
out for the first of two round robins scheduled.
Light northerly winds of around 3-4 knots allowed
the race Committee to start 10 of the 12 regattas
in the program.
The first match saw the Swedes of Victory Challenge
up against the United Internet Team germany. The
Germans, with skipper Michael Hestbaek at the helm,
finish approximately thirty seconds ahead of Mattias
Rahm.
Desafio Espanol 2007 and Mascalzone Latino-Capitalia
Team competed in the second match which saw Italy’s
Vasco Vascotto take victory over Spaniard Santiago
Lopez Vazquez.
Racing continued with United Internet Team Germany
triumphing again, this time beating Desafio Espagnol
2007 over the finish line by 20 seconds. Victory
Challenge meanwhile beat Mascalzone Latino by 25
seconds.
In the third and final flight of the first round
robin Mascalzone Latino finished just ahead of Team
Germany in a hard-fought regatta and Victory Challenge
beat Desafio Espanol 2007.
The final two flights saw a strong United Internet
Team Germany beat first Victory Challenge and then
Desafio Espanol 2007.
The Spaniards lost out again to Mascalzone Latino
– Capitalia Team and in the final race Mascalzone’s
Vascotto was pipped to the post by Victory Challenge.
Racing is scheduled to start at 11.30 am tomorrow
with the final two races of the second round robin
followed by the semi-finals. The forecast predicts
similar conditions to today, with clear blue skies
and light and variable breezes.
